Registrati­on for PG courses begins at Delhi University

- HT Correspond­ent htreporter­s@hindustant­imes.com

Delhi University on Monday started online registrati­on for admissions to postgradua­te, Mphil, and PHD courses for the upcoming 2021-22 academic session, with officials saying that over 20,000 visitors logged into the portal till 9 pm -- four hours after the portal was launched.

The registrati­ons for undergradu­ate courses will start on August 2.

Candidates can log in to the website -- admission.uod.ac.in -till August 21 to register for the entrance-based courses.

“Over 20,000 visitors have visited our portal and around 10,000 have already logged in. They’re in the various stages of filling the form,” said Sanjeev Singh, joint director at DU Computer Centre.

Rajeev Gupta, chairperso­n of admissions, said “more than 4,500 visitors logged in within 15 minutes”.

All postgradua­te courses at Delhi University have entrance tests -- DU entrance test (DUET) -- in addition to merit-based admission for DU graduates.

The dates for the entrance test will be announced by the National Testing Agency which will conduct the test in 27 centres, including in Cuttack, Lucknow

Among the changes in the revamped admissions portal is a live chatbot which answers queries posted by applicants in realtime. The university also announced live sessions to answer queries from postgradua­te and research programme aspirants.

“The University of Delhi will organise virtual open days for the benefit of all prospectiv­e candidates [for PG, M.phil and PHD courses from July 27-30 at 5pm. These virtual open days have been planned to assist the prospectiv­e candidates in the registrati­on and the admission process. Applicants will have the option to interact with the panellists and the webinar will also be telecasted live on DU’S official Facebook and Youtube channels,” Gupta said.

Singh said that they had worked out a “seamless” admission process this year.

Entrance tests begin at Jamia Millia Islamia

Entrance test for admission to various UG, PG, and diploma programmes at Jamia Millia Islamia began on Monday at various test centres on the Jamia campus in two shifts. The entrance exams will continue till August 28 amid Covid-safety protocols.
